Как задать заголовок h1 для категорий товаров Woocommerce?
Добрый день. Возникла необходимость заделать заголовок h1 категорий товаров т.к. по умолчанию стоят h3. Есть функция:
if(strpos($_SERVER['SERVER_NAME'] . $_SERVER['REQUEST_URI'], '/product-category/'))
add_filter ( 'woocommerce_show_page_title' , 'mayak_woocommerce_product_cat_h1' , 10 , 2 );
function mayak_product_cat_h1(){
$pch = get_term_meta (get_queried_object()->term_id, 'h1', true);
echo ''.$pch.'';
if(empty($pch)){
echo ''.get_queried_object()->name.'';
}
}
function mayak_woocommerce_product_cat_h1(){
return mayak_product_cat_h1($pch);
}
Всё работает, h1 задаётся, но слетают хлебные крошки и вообще название категории приобретает стандартный вид, отличный от темы. Подскажите, что добавить , что бы и h1 остался и название категории выглядело как надо.
Не подскажете в каком именно файле шаблона? Такая ситуация только с категориями магазина и со страницами меток. Заголовки всех остальных страниц в т.ч. и страниц товаров имею изначально h1.